Ingredients:

INGREDIENT NOTES
Bologna Any kind will do, from thick deli slices to pre-packaged cuts.
Bread Traditional white bread or any bread of your preference.
Sliced Cheese Choose your favorite cheese for that ooey-gooey goodness.
Mayo/Mustard Add a tangy kick with mayo or mustard, based on your taste.
Tomato Fresh tomato slices bring a burst of freshness to the sandwich.
Onion Sliced onions for that touch of crunch and flavor.

Instructions:

  1. Preparation: Begin by spraying your skillet with oil or heating a small amount of oil over medium-high heat. This will ensure the bologna cooks evenly and achieves that coveted caramelized taste.
  2. Prepping the Bologna: If you’re using bologna from a deli, there’s no need to remove the red rim. However, for brands like Bar S or Oscar Meyer, peel away the red rim and discard it. This step ensures your bologna cooks uniformly.
  3. Spread the Dressing: Take your bread slices and spread mayo or mustard (or any dressing of your choice) across them. This will infuse the sandwich with a delightful burst of flavor.
  4. Slice and Dice: Slice your preferred vegetables, such as tomatoes and onions, to add an extra layer of texture and taste to the sandwich. It’s best to have everything ready before you start frying the bologna, as it cooks quickly.
  5. Frying the Bologna: Once the skillet is heated, place the bologna slices in the pan. Listen to the sizzle as they begin to cook. As you notice the center starting to bubble, make two slits in the shape of an “X” to prevent curling while frying.
  6. Cooking Time: Fry the bologna for about three minutes on each side over medium heat. The perfect fried bologna is slightly charred, imparting a caramelized richness that elevates the overall flavor.
  7. Remove and Prepare: When the bologna is ready, carefully remove it from the pan and place it on a paper towel to absorb any excess grease. You can gently pat it down to further reduce the oil content.
  8. Assembling the Sandwich: Now it’s time to build your Fried Bologna masterpiece. Place the fried bologna on your prepared bread slices, and layer on your choice of sliced cheese, tomatoes, and onions for added freshness and crunch.
  9. Final Touch: Top the sandwich with the remaining slice of bread, press it down gently, and take a moment to appreciate the symphony of flavors and textures you’ve created. Pair your sandwich with your favorite chips, and you’re ready to enjoy an East Texas classic.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it essential to peel the red rim from bologna before frying? Yes, peeling the red rim is recommended, especially for brands like Bar S or Oscar Meyer. This ensures even cooking and prevents any unwanted bitterness in the final sandwich.

Can I use a different type of cheese for my Fried Bologna sandwich? Absolutely! Feel free to experiment with various cheeses to find the one that suits your taste buds best. Cheddar, Swiss, and even pepper jack can all be delightful choices.

Are there alternative dressings I can use instead of mayo or mustard? Certainly! While mayo and mustard add a classic touch, you can get creative with dressings like ranch, aioli, or even pesto for a unique flavor profile.

Why is it important to cut slits in the bologna while frying? Cutting slits in the bologna helps prevent it from curling up as it cooks, resulting in a more even and visually appealing final product.
